Package: efax
Version: 1:0.9a-9

The attachments should be done like this:

   for f in $FILES
   do
 echo "--EFAX_MAIL"
 echo "Content-Type: image/tiff; name=\"$f.tiff\""
 echo "Content-Transfer-Encoding: base64"
 echo "Content-Disposition: attachment; filename=\"$f.tiff\""
 echo ""
 $EFIX -M <$f
   done
   echo "--EFAX_MAIL--"

The '--EFAX_MAIL--' is a terminator for the whole message not each
attachment.

Package: efax
Version: 1:0.9a-9
Severity: normal

Running   'fax view  file_name', if the environment variable LC_NUMERIC
is set to it_IT, or fr_FR,  de_DE, es_ES  (with or without @euro) i get
the following error:

efix: Sat Sep 14 21:30:18 2002 Error: bad units: .7cm'
Warning: unknown JFIF revision number 1076646016.1073827840
stdin: unknown or unsupported image type

Potato version didn't have this bug.
